I did my first 100 percent Cotton yarn wick today and I have to say I'm extremely impressed. I boiled the cotton first and allowed it to dry completely... then did a 4/5 (32 gauge) Kanthal wire wrap and installed it into my Phoenix RBA. I allowed around 15 minutes to 'soak' in the eJuices (I know! Should have been much longer but I was curious!).... and! I'm happy to report I have had no problems with any dry burning or anything like that. Out of the gate it performed (far better) than the 2mm Silica wicking. The flavor is much much better and I'm even getting more vapor (which surprised me) using the same juices I used with the Silica wicking. Another thing I noticed, (which I was wondering anyone else has experienced), is my Kanthal wire is NOT getting gunked up/or charred like it does with the Silica. My VV GS Sub 2.0 mod indicates almost 100 vapes since installation and usually the wick/wire is already pretty gunked up and charred looking by now.... but honestly, I keep checking and my wick/wire are still shiny and silver (Well, the wick is still white and the wire is silver).... which is really kind of blowing my mind... in a good way. Has any one else noticed this enhanced performance with your wire & wicks since transitioning to cotton?

So I did hybrid mesh/cotton for AGA-T+, it does work... but the flavor is not there at all. It's very faint so is vapor production. Comparing flavor to dripping rba and clouds to one time I managed to get it work for few hours with mesh wick...
second time I wrapped some cotton around wick, after burning away last one, and it was too much cotton? It was over saturated to the point when I couldn't get vapor with 4.2 volts on 2.2 resistance...
Third try, with much less cotton. 2.2 ohms, 3.9 volts and no flavor... no clouds... 4.1 volts and full mouth of burnt cotton...
What am I doing wrong?
Mesh was lightly burnt before wrapping and torched twice, without quench, after wrapping.
